‘Gautam Gambhir quota’: Fans furious as Harshit Rana picked over Mohammed Siraj, Prasidh Krishna for Asia Cup
India has recently announced its squad for the upcoming Asia Cup 2025, and there have been some surprising selections that have sparked debates and controversies among cricket fans. One of the most talked-about decisions is the inclusion of Harshit Rana over more established pacers like Prasidh Krishna and Mohammed Siraj.
### Rising Star Harshit Rana to Make Asia Cup Debut
Harshit Rana, a promising fast bowler from the Kolkata Knight Riders (KKR), has been given the opportunity to represent India in the Asia Cup for the first time. Despite not being a household name like some of his counterparts, Rana has caught the eye of the selectors with his impressive performances in recent tournaments, including the Champions Trophy and the Border-Gavaskar Trophy.
### Surprising Exclusions of Prasidh Krishna and Mohammed Siraj
The decision to leave out Prasidh Krishna, who had a standout season in the IPL, and Mohammed Siraj has raised eyebrows among fans and experts alike. Both bowlers have been in excellent form and were expected to play a crucial role in India’s pace attack. Some speculate that their exclusion could be due to the upcoming Test series against the West Indies, which starts just four days after the conclusion of the Asia Cup. Managing the workload of the players might have influenced the selectors’ decision.
### Standby Players Named for the Asia Cup
In addition to the 15-member squad, the Indian selectors have also named five standby players who will be ready to step in if needed during the tournament. Among the standbys are Prasidh Krishna, all-rounders Riyan Parag and Washington Sundar, wicket-keeper Dhruv Jurel, and batsman Yashasvi Jaiswal. These players will be waiting in the wings for a chance to prove their worth if called upon.
